Publisher's summary

It is the autumn of 2019. Merlin’s wayward apprentice has escaped from the tower of London with his raven familiars. Legend foretells that the white tower, then England, will fall. Can King Arthur, a weary veteran of the English Civil War, Waterloo, and the Somme, prevent the Ravenmaster from exacting his revenge?

some good scenes but not compelling

I like the premise of King Arthur returning to save the day, but I wasn't drawn into this story. The vignettes featuring Arthur incognito changing the tides of war at various historical British battles were not compelling. Also, I found the modern day villain hard to credit. But some scenes are excellent, especially the opening battle when Mordred and Arthur fought to the death. I do recommend THE SUMMER TREE trilogy by Guy Gavriel Kay for readers interested to see Arthur Lancelot and Guenevere returning to a modern day fantastical epic battle.
Decent narration.

King Arthur Returns!

This unique story starts in 2019 but really begins with the death of King Arthur in his final battle, a battle that pits father against son. King Arthur’s death is just the beginning, Merlin intercedes with his magic putting Arthur and his Knights into a deep sleep so they can awake in the future when England will need their help again. This story moves smoothly back and forth between the past and present with the excellent narration provided by Nigel Peever. You are not left with a cliffhanger ending and could end the story here but I’m sure you will want to continue on to “Agravain’s Escape” because why would you want this story to end. Arthur -- through time and danger

Having enjoyed Jacob Sannox's debut novel, Dark Oak, I was looking forward to The Ravenmaster's Revenge. I wasn't disappointed. This time it's historical fantasy, with King Arthur and his remaining knights honouring their vow to return when danger threatens England. Arthur's opponent is Merlin's apprentice -- the Ravenmaster. If his Ravens leave the Tower, then England falls . . . .
It's a tightly written, fast-paced novel that moves effortlessly back and forth from great events in England's past to modern times as the Ravenmaster pursues his aims.
I'm glad that Nigel Peever is again the narrator of another Sannox book. His beautifully modulated voice captures the majesty of the once and future king, and the menace of the dangers he and his knights face. Top drawer.
